Mumbai Indians won the tenth edition of Indian Premier League for the third time against Rising Super Giants in final match at Uppal Stadium in Hyderabad.
Two times IPL winner Mumbai Indians won the toss and choose to bat, couldn’t put a huge score on the board.
Under the captain-ship of Rohit Sharma, Mumbai team scored 129 runs losing 8 wickets with a leading score of 47 runs from Krunal Pandya.
The top players’ honours went in the way of Sunrisers Hyderabad as the Orange cap was won by David Warner, who scored 641 runs and Bhuvneshwar Kumar won the Purple cup with 26 wickets.
RPS’ Jaydev Unadkat finished second highest wicket-taker with 24 wickets.
Glenn Maxwell hit the most sixes with 26 maximums this season while Hardik Pandya scored the most runs in an over with 28 runs coming in an Ashok Dinda over.
A massive 705 sixes were hit throughout the season with Mumbai’s Wankhede stadium witnessing the most – 104.
